The Sealy Lady Tigers fell to Bellville in straight sets last Friday night at home. Sealy battled hard throughout the match but came up just short against the highly regarded Bellville squad. Sealy fell to 6-3 in District 25-4A play and sit firmly in third place in district behind Bellville and Needville. Sealy traveled to Navasota for a district contest Tuesday night. The results were not available at press time. Sealy will host their final home game Friday against Needville before closing out the season next Tuesday against Brookshire Royal.
